Q: What happens if the Quillstream schema registry's signing store gets sealed?

A: Happens after any unclean shutdown — schema publishes just queue up, nothing's lost. Any reviewer with break-glass rights can unseal it from the admin console. You'll be prompted for the recovery passphrase, which for the current rotation is the following.

vault phrase of taweg-kafof = oliax-zorael

# Break-Glass: Catalog Cache Invalidation

Scope: the Pinrow product catalog at Veldstone Retail. If stale prices persist after a purge and the Hollowmere invalidation queue is wedged, use break-glass to flush the edge tier directly. Contractors: get verbal sign-off from the catalog lead first. Steps: open the Hollowmere admin shell, select emergency-flush, confirm the tenant, and run it once — repeated flushes thrash the origin. Access is logged and expires after 20 minutes. Unseal the admin shell with the passphrase below.

recovery phrase for kahop-tajog: istix-casvan

**Ticket QF-2218: Cron drift on the Bramblehook report workers.** For anyone new: scheduled jobs on the night shard have been firing 40–90 seconds late, and the drift grows across the week. Current theory is NTP sync on the older Tidewell hosts is losing to a misbehaving virtualization clock. We've added drift metrics and a weekly resync. Please reproduce only on hosts running the instrumented build recorded below.

trace token, kawip-fafog: htk14_26e64c4d35154e

## Blue-Green Deploys: LedgerSpin Billing Worker

Release managers cut over LedgerSpin via the Switchyard console. Deploy green, wait for invoice replay parity (usually 4 minutes), then flip traffic. Never flip during the hourly reconciliation window — check the Tollbooth dashboard first. Rollback is a single flip back to blue; no data migration needed since both colors share the ChargeVault store. Flips require authenticating against the internal Switchyard API before any traffic change.

app token of tagef-tafog = qvz3-7n0